In 2020-2021, 10,054 people earned their degree in philosophy, making the major the 83rd most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, philosophy gra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$30,510 and had an average of $21,514 in loans still to pay off.

Across New York, there were 876 philosophy graduates with average earnings and debt of $30,952 and $21,989 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 103 philosophy graduates with average earnings and debt of $61,893 and $0 respectively.

For this year’s “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Philosophy Major in New York” ranking, we looked at 18 colleges that offer a degree in philosophy. This a ranking of the schools where the largest percentage of students has enrolled in philosophy.
